Sorry, this listing is no longer accepting applications. Don’t worry, we have more awesome opportunities and internships for you.

Web Full Stack QA Engineer

DYL

Web Full Stack QA Engineer

Culver City, CA
Full Time
Paid
  • Responsibilities

    COMPANY PROFILE:

    We are a fast growing, innovative SaaS/VoIP solution provider that is transforming the way SMBs engage their prospects/leads & customers by combining multiple products such as enterprise phone system, sales CRM, cloud contact center & lead management into one easy to use and efficient platform. We have thousands of customers in U.S with huge growth potential into other countries and verticals. DYL is also the place for talented, creative and passionate people who are excited about new technologies, being on the cutting edge of enterprise sales automation and has been voted one of the top places to work in LA.

    JOB SUMMARY:

    We are looking for a passionate and dynamic Junior QA Engineer to join our Engineering team. The ideal candidate will bring their passion for building efficient systems, problem-solving, collaboration, constant learning, and have a curiosity about how things work and how they can be improved. You will be working with a lean, efficient, multitasking and diverse group of people to create a solution at scale, delivering high reliability and an exceptional user experience using some of the latest technology like React, Kubernetes, NodeJS, Go, EFK and Postgres among others. 

    KEY RESPONSIBILITIES:

    • Creating and delivering superlative bug free user experiences.
    • Thriving in a highly skilled engineering team.
    • Following best SDLC practices around development, testing, source control, and deployment.
    • Collaborating with a diverse team of designers, developers, and engineers.
    • Working in a dynamic, agile, team environment developing awesome web applications.
    • Working with others to thoroughly test solutions prior to deployment.
    • Working in tandem with services, support, sales and marketing departments to further the company's business objectives
    • Being passionate about testing and test driven development.
    • Driving the quality of complex software and systems, including identification of bugs, bottlenecks and optimization of performance.
    • Passionately drive the definition of test cases, create test plans and procedures and lead the definition and execution of manual and/or automated test scripts.
    • Being the principal lead/driver of the development and execution of test cases and procedures.

    THE IDEAL CANDIDATE WILL POSESS THE FOLLOWING:

    • 2+ years experience working with test tools like Selenium, Robot Framework, JMeter, Postman, Locust, Mocha Required
    • Bachelor's or Master's degree in software engineering, computer science, or a STEM field at a minimum
    • Minimum of 1 - 2 years experience in a software QA role.
    • Experience working in Virtualized environments, Cloud Computing like GCP or other cloud platforms
    • Experience working in Agile development and Scrum environments
    • Comfortable and proficient using git and Github for source control
    • Knowledge and Implementation of CI/CD systems, tools and technologies
    • Solid experience writing Javascript and/or Python code
    • Knowledge/Experience in all phases of the SDLC 
    • Jira/Confluence experience is a plus.
    • Experience writing SQL unit tests is a big plus
    • Good Linux CLI skills

    TO BE SUCCESSFUL YOU MUST:

    • Be able to troubleshoot and debug complex applications and systems
    • Be a good team player, able to wear many hats and jump in where needed
    • Be humble and hungry
    • Be focused on the customer experience and satisfaction.
    • Have excellent verbal and written communication skills
    • Have excellent problem solving and debugging skills
    • Have the ability to prioritize and handle multiple tasks
    • Be a self-starter, detail and closure-oriented in task management
    • Be excellent at anticipating issues and risks in a complex system and is able to identify direct solutions.
    • Be very efficient at working on a Linux environment

    Compensation and benefits:

    • Competitive salary plus great opportunities for advancement.
    • Low stress, high productivity working environment.
    • Health Benefits 
    • Paid Time Off
    • Friendly and Fun work environment.

     

    Applying for this position:

    • Please provide a cover letter, resume, and code samples and links to your work or portfolio.
    • Please include your experience level programming.
    • Please include 3 professional references.